Keep your carpets clean by Vacuuming weekly! This will help keep dirt, beach sand, or hiking mud or dust from accumulating in your carpets

Summer is filled with beaches, hiking, and many other fun times that may not agree with your home’s carpet very much! Regular vacuuming can greatly improve the health and cleanliness of your home by preventing dirt and dust from building up in your carpets. Over time, these particles can become trapped in the fibers of the carpet and can be difficult to remove without professional help. Vacuuming at least once a week can help prevent this buildup and make it easier to maintain your carpets in the long run. Not only does this help improve the overall appearance of your home, but it also creates a healthier environment by reducing allergens and bacteria that can be harmful to you and your family. Take off your shoes before entering the house to prevent outside dirt and grime from getting into the carpets

Did you know that taking off your shoes before entering the house can go a long way in protecting your carpets from outside dirt and grime? Shoes tend to accumulate various pollutants, tracked in from streets and sidewalks. Once inside, these contaminants can easily get trapped within the fibers of your carpets and rugs, causing wear and tear over time. By simply removing your shoes at the entryway, you can greatly reduce the amount of dirt and grime that enters your home, helping to maintain a cleaner and healthier living environment. Invest in a dehumidifier to control moisture levels and discourage mold growth

Moisture levels in your home can lead to unpleasant odors and, worse yet, mold growth. Investing in a dehumidifier is an effective way to control humidity and prevent mold from taking hold. A dehumidifier works by removing excess moisture from the air, leaving your home feeling more comfortable while reducing the chances of mold growth. Clean up spills immediately with a damp cloth or paper towel

Barbecue Sauce, ketchup, bread crumbs, and many other spills happen during the summer months – it’s just a fact of summertime life. But the important thing is how we deal with them. It’s crucial to clean up spills as soon as possible, especially on surfaces like hardwood or tile that can be easily damaged by liquids. The best way to do this is with a damp cloth or paper towel. Simply dampen the cloth or paper towel in water and gently blot the spill until it’s absorbed. Don’t rub the spill, as this can spread it around or push it deeper into the surface. Taking care of spills promptly not only preserves the cleanliness of our homes and workplaces but also ensures the longevity of our surfaces.
